VAMOS Quality Team meeting

Apr 13, 2021 | 0 comments

On April 13, 2021, our VAMOS Quality Team with members from the University of Padua, the Francisco Morazán National Pedagogical University, the Technological University of Honduras, and the Federal University of Pará met for the first time. Bringing together international project and Erasmus+ experience, the members kicked off the meeting by familiarizing themselves with Quality Assurance terminology while also updating their toolbox with new procedures such as Result Based Management. After approving the Quality Plan, the team discussed ideas for evaluating activities and outputs within VAMOS.

Next to relying on quantitative evaluation methods, the members will also include qualitative evaluation methods to better assess the achievement of objectives and the effectiveness of trainings, meetings, and conferences. As part of Quality Assurance, our project coordinator will also be in contact with two external advisors who will evaluate the delivery of VAMOS’ objectives and provide feedback.
